Elfin Cove, Alaska, is a small coastal community located within Hoonah-Angoon Census Area. With a population of around 30 residents, the town is known for its picturesque scenery and remote setting, which can significantly impact delivery times. The predominantly maritime geography, characterized by dense forests and rugged coastlines, contributes to limited access points for logistics providers. USPS delivery operations in such remote areas can encounter challenges, especially when weather conditions fluctuate, as the region experiences heavy precipitation and storms, particularly in autumn and winter.
The USPS serves this small community primarily through marine transportation, with deliveries often scheduled on a less frequent basis due to the logistical complexities involved. Because of Elfin Cove's limited infrastructure and seasonal weather variations, packages may take several days to arrive, especially when dependent on ferry schedules.
